Skip to content
  • hyatt's avatar
    Fix for 3016385, menus on webreference.com don't show up. · 953820ad
    hyatt authored
    	Fixes to make webreference.com menus show up.  This involved
    	fixing layers to not clip positioned objects when overflow:hidden
    	is set, fixing the stupid clip/sync layout hack for livepage
    	so that it doesn't break webreference, and implementing
    	navigator.productSub (right now the date is set to
    	Christmas 2002).
    
            Reviewed by gramps/maciej.
    
            * khtml/ecma/kjs_navigator.cpp:
            (Navigator::getValueProperty):
            * khtml/ecma/kjs_navigator.h:
            * khtml/ecma/kjs_navigator.lut.h:
            * khtml/rendering/render_box.cpp:
            (RenderBox::getOverflowClipRect):
            * khtml/rendering/render_box.h:
            * khtml/rendering/render_flow.cpp:
            (RenderFlow::layout):
            * khtml/rendering/render_layer.cpp:
            (RenderLayer::paint):
            (RenderLayer::nodeAtPoint):
            (RenderLayer::constructZTree):
            * khtml/rendering/render_layer.h:
            * khtml/rendering/render_object.cpp:
            (RenderObject::setLayouted):
            * khtml/rendering/render_object.h:
    
    
    git-svn-id: http://svn.webkit.org/repository/webkit/trunk@3054 268f45cc-cd09-0410-ab3c-d52691b4dbfc
    953820ad